Under a decision made by the Minimum Wage Commission, the new minimum wage given to workers above 16 years of age will be net 658.95 TL with an increase of 28.99 TL.
Earlier, the Minimum Wage Commission decided to increase the minimum wage for workers above 16 years of age by 4.7 percent during the first half of the year and by 65.1 percent in the second six months.
Accordingly, the minimum wage for a single employee older than 16, which currently amounts to 796.50 TL gross (net 629.96 TL), will increase to 837 TL gross (net 658.95 TL) after the 5.1 percent rise. (1 USD equals 1.63 TL)
For those under the age of 16, there will be a 25.77 TL increase starting from July. The minimum wage for the workers younger than 16, which is currently 679.50 TL gross (net 546.20 TL), will rise up to 715.50 TL gross (net 571.97 TL) as of July 1.
The new minimum wage will be valid till December 31, 2011. |
